Output 743cbb56129669c2f4b247ab08cb45f39d70d944bb8b8d6a6f1ea10da8f30047:2

value
2850786
script pubkey
OP_0 OP_PUSHBYTES_20 6bc59cc58e4316e6c577b41345d2a358366d79c1
address
bc1qd0zee3vwgvtwd3thksf5t54rtqmx67wph2clfp
transaction
743cbb56129669c2f4b247ab08cb45f39d70d944bb8b8d6a6f1ea10da8f30047
confirmations
242896
spent
true